Manhattan to JFK in 36 minutes
The AirTrain automated light rail system links the nine passenger terminals of John F. Kennedy International Airport (JFK) with the central terminal, rental car area, and parking lots. When designed and built, the AirTrain’s capacity was 34,000 passengers a day, making it the second most heavily used airport access system in the United States at the time.
The AirTrain extends to intermodal transfer stations in Queens that connect to New York City Transit (NYCT) subway and bus systems, and the Long Island Rail Road (LIRR). A trip from midtown Manhattan, which formerly took more than two hours in bad weather or unusually heavy traffic, now takes about 36 minutes.
